Karlaga Population - Debagarh, Orissa

Karlaga is a medium size village located in Kundheigola Block of Debagarh district, Orissa with total 428 families residing. The Karlaga village has population of 1944 of which 986 are males while 958 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Karlaga village population of children with age 0-6 is 243 which makes up 12.50 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Karlaga village is 972 which is lower than Orissa state average of 979. Child Sex Ratio for the Karlaga as per census is 800, lower than Orissa average of 941.

Karlaga village has lower literacy rate compared to Orissa. In 2011, literacy rate of Karlaga village was 70.02 % compared to 72.87 % of Orissa. In Karlaga Male literacy stands at 80.61 % while female literacy rate was 59.41 %.

Caste Factor

Karlaga village of Debagarh has substantial population of Schedule Caste.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 28.81 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 8.90 % of total population in Karlaga village.

Work Profile

In Karlaga village out of total population, 780 were engaged in work activities. 12.56 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 87.44 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months.
